Ticket #— Floor 9 Opening Prep, Brindlemoor House

Hi facilities folks, Floor 9 opens to staff next Monday and we need a few things squared away before then. Lift access is live, but the two side doors by the kitchenette are still on the old lock config — please reprogram them before Friday. Also, signage for the quiet rooms hasn't arrived, so pop up the temporary printed ones for now. Until the badge readers sync, the interim door code for Floor 9 is below.

door code, bajop-bajog: bdg-DSWAC-43621

## Runbook: Releasing Sketchloom Undo/Redo

Before cutting a Sketchloom release, exercise the undo/redo stack manually: create a diagram, move three nodes, delete an edge, then undo five times and redo five times. The history stack must replay deterministically — any divergence blocks the release. Also confirm undo survives a tab reload, since history is persisted locally. Once QA signs off, build the release bundle and sign it prior to upload; unsigned bundles are rejected by the updater. Sign the bundle with the key below.

deploy key for kajof-fajop: bky6_gDHw9Q

Onboarding: Queue Migration (Project Relay)

We are replacing the homegrown job queue, Pushcart, with Relay, our new broker-backed system. Pushcart still handles billing jobs; everything else has moved. Your first tasks will involve porting the remaining Pushcart consumers to Relay workers. Code lives in the `relay-workers` repo; local setup instructions are in its README. Relay's admin endpoints require authentication, and contractors get a scoped key rather than a full service account. Your scoped key for the Relay admin API is below.

app token of bahaf-tajeg = zpat23_SjjsllwiLmXbtS65veZaV47